About 673573 PIN Code

The PIN code 673573 belongs to Chamal in Kerala, India. It serves 8 locations and is administered by the Kerala Circle of India Post.

673573 is part of the Kozhikode district and Kozhikode taluka / block. Use this PIN code when sending mail, parcels or registered post to addresses in this area. For neighbouring areas, please check the related pincodes shown below.

What is the difference between branch type and division?

The branch type (BO = Branch Office, SO = Sub Office, HO = Head Office) describes the post office hierarchy, while the division and circle are administrative groupings under India Post.
